Live Video Pen and Ink Drawing Workshop to support Butterfly Conservation

June 1 @ 10:00 am - 12:00 pm

£21

Fancy learning how to carve and use your own bamboo pen from the comfort of your own home, create your own beautiful illustrations with ease, and raise money for charity all in one fell swoop?

The focus of this exciting live online drawing class, held on 1st June 2024 at 10am, will be an inky Peacock butterfly sat on top of a Buddleja bloom. You’ll receive a craft kit in the post with all the materials one week prior to the workshop, so when the live class begins you’ll have everything you need. The full lesson will include a step-by-step of how to hand-carve your own bamboo pen, drawing exercises including mark-making, colour mixing and illustrative techniques, and then a guided final piece on a ready-prepared greeting card of the peacock and buddleja as shown in the image.

In your kit you will receive two blank watercolour greeting cards and eco envelopes, so you can try your hand at creating the same design twice, or making your own second design! Don’t worry if you can’t make it on the day, the session will be recorded for you to enjoy in your own time afterwards. The craft kit will include a ready-made bamboo pen, powdered inks, a £5 voucher for katemoby.com, two luxury blank greeting cards with envelopes, and all practice papers and reference materials. Suitable for ages 7+.

£10 of the ticket price goes straight to Butterfly Conservation, so you can learn a new skill whilst raising crucial funds to help butterflies and moths in decline in the UK.
